The Powertrain Control Module in your 1998 Chrysler Concorde acts as the central computer for the powertrain, processing input from dozens of sensors to control fuel injection, idle speed, emissions, and automatic transmission shifting. It stores the vehicle identification number and odometer reading in permanent memory, and it monitors the California emissions compliance through the on-board diagnostics system. When this module fails internally, you may experience no-start conditions, random stalling, or harsh transmission shifts. The module also manages the speed control servo, which controls cruise control operation. Replacement requires either a new or refurbished unit, and you must transfer the original identification data to the new computer to ensure the vehicle operates correctly. The Powertrain Control Module on this vehicle is located in the passenger-side front corner of the engine compartment, near the firewall. Access requires removing the air intake duct and the PCM mounting bracket. The replacement process involves disconnecting the negative battery cable first, then unplugging the three electrical connectors from the module. The old unit is unbolted and removed, and the new unit is installed in reverse order. According to factory labor guidelines, the remove-and-replace procedure books at 0.4 hours, while the post-replacement relearn procedure requires an additional 0.5 hours. After installation, you must reconnect the battery and program the new module with the original vehicle identification number and mileage using the DRB scan tool.

Work with the ignition off, and treat the module as static-sensitive: avoid touching the connector pins at any point.

After installing a replacement PCM in your 1998 Chrysler Concorde, the factory procedure requires connecting the DRB scan tool to reprogram the new module with your vehicle’s original identification number and the original odometer reading. This step is critical because the module stores this data for emissions compliance and anti-theft purposes. You also need to reinstall the speed control servo and bracket if removed, tighten all fasteners to specification, reconnect the negative battery cable, and then reprogram the radio and clock. When the Powertrain Control Module fails on this vehicle, common symptoms include a no-start condition where the engine cranks but will not run, intermittent stalling especially at idle, and rough running that may set multiple diagnostic trouble codes. You may notice the scan tool cannot communicate with the module, or the transmission may shift harshly or get stuck in one gear. The check engine light typically illuminates, and you may see fault codes related to internal module errors. Code P0601 indicates internal memory check sum failure, which often prevents the engine from starting. Other associated codes that may appear include P0600, P0622, P1682, P1683, P1685, P1686, P1687, P1695, P1696, P1697, and P1698, all pointing to various internal PCM faults.
This vehicle is known to set multiple module-internal trouble codes when the PCM develops internal failures. These codes indicate various memory, communication, and processor issues within the control module itself rather than sensor or actuator problems.

Chrysler issued recall Rc-814-99 for California emissions, requiring a PCM reprogram to address specific emissions control faults on affected vehicles. Additionally, service bulletin #18-037-05 covers flash programming failure recovery using the DRBIII scan tool, providing a procedure to recover from programming errors if the initial flash attempt fails. Both bulletins relate to the PCM programming process and are relevant when performing replacement or reprogramming on this vehicle.
